Amplitude analysis of the decay $\overline{B}^0 \to K_{S}^0 \pi^+ \pi^-$ and first observation of the CP asymmetry in $\overline{B}^0 \to K^{*}(892)^- \pi^+$ : arXiv

2018 
The time-integrated untagged Dalitz plot of the three-body hadronic charmless decay B¯ 0 → K0 Sπþπ− is studied using a pp collision data sample recorded with the LHCb detector, corresponding to an integrated luminosity of 3.0 fb−1. The decay amplitude is described with an isobar model. Relative contributions of the isobar amplitudes to the B¯ 0 → K0 Sπþπ− decay branching fraction and CP asymmetries of the flavor-specific amplitudes are measured. The CP asymmetry between the conjugate B¯ 0 → K*892Þ−πþ and B0 → K*(892()-π− decay rates is determined to be −0.308 0.062.
